What Did the 1998 Selectivity Finding Actually Measure?

A selectivity claim is only as good as the things it was tested against, and this one named them.

The pituitary does not release growth hormone in isolation. Compounds acting on it can also move adrenocorticotropic hormone, cortisol, prolactin and other outputs, and earlier secretagogues did.

The 1998 characterisation measured those other outputs rather than measuring growth hormone alone and reporting a clean result by omission.

That is the methodological point. A compound tested only for the effect it was designed to produce cannot generate evidence of selectivity, because nothing was measured that could have contradicted it.

Ipamorelin peptide was compared against reference secretagogues in the same experimental system, which is what makes the comparison interpretable rather than anecdotal.

The finding was that growth hormone release occurred at concentrations where the other measured pituitary outputs did not move appreciably.

What follows from that is narrower than the way the result is usually repeated. It establishes a separation across a measured concentration range in a defined preparation.

It does not establish that no separation collapses at higher concentrations, in a different species, or on outputs nobody measured. Selectivity is a range statement rather than a property, and the published range is the useful part.

Why Is Ipamorelin Peptide Harder to Make Than Five Residues Suggests?

A pentapeptide sounds trivial to make and ipamorelin peptide is not, because two of the five residues are not standard amino acids.

Alpha-aminoisobutyric acid carries two methyl groups on the alpha carbon rather than one methyl and one hydrogen. That extra bulk makes the residue sterically hindered and slows the coupling step that attaches the next residue to it.

A slow coupling is an incomplete coupling. Chains that failed to react carry forward and appear in the final product as deletion sequences missing that residue.

Naphthylalanine is a bulky aromatic residue with the same consequence for the coupling that follows it.

So the two positions in ipamorelin peptide that are chemically distinctive are also the two positions where synthesis fails most often, and a deletion at either produces a peptide with the correct four remaining residues and the wrong pharmacology.

On a 712 dalton molecule a single deletion is a large proportional mass change, roughly ten to fifteen percent depending which residue is missing, which is the one advantage of working with a short peptide.

That change is unmissable on any mass spectrometer, so the failure mode here is visible rather than hidden, unlike the situation on a 44-residue chain.

A certificate that reports observed mass against calculated mass therefore closes most of the risk on this compound, provided the calculated figure is for the correct construct.

What Do the D-Residues Contribute?

Two residues in ipamorelin peptide are in the D-configuration and that is a deliberate design decision rather than a synthesis artefact.

Proteases evolved against L-amino acids, which is what ribosomes produce and what natural proteins are made of. A D-residue presents the wrong spatial arrangement to a protease active site.

The enzyme can still bind the region but cannot orient the scissile bond correctly, so cleavage rates drop sharply.

Placing D-residues at positions a protease would otherwise target is the standard route to extending the useful life of a short peptide, and it costs nothing at the receptor if the receptor tolerates the change.

That last condition is not automatic. A D-substitution flips the side chain to the opposite face, and for many binding sites that abolishes activity.

For ipamorelin peptide it did not, which is a finding rather than an assumption, and it is why the molecule works at all in the configuration it has.

For a laboratory the practical consequence is that the compound survives longer in a preparation containing serum or tissue homogenate than an all-L peptide of the same length would.

Verification of configuration is a separate question from verification of mass, since a D-residue and its L-counterpart weigh exactly the same. Chiral analysis is the only method that distinguishes them and most certificates do not include it.

One practical note on how to ask about this. A supplier asked whether the configurations were verified will usually say the synthesis used the correct protected building blocks, which is a statement about inputs rather than about the product.

That answer is not worthless. Chiral building blocks are what determine the configuration, and racemisation during coupling is the failure it does not rule out.

Ipamorelin peptide is short enough that this risk is small, and knowing which question was answered is still better than assuming.

What Should an Ipamorelin Certificate Show?

Six fields cover ipamorelin peptide, and one of them is specific to any peptide containing non-coded residues.

Observed mass against calculated mass. At 712 daltons any deletion is a large proportional change, so this single figure carries more weight here than on a long peptide.

Purity by reverse-phase HPLC with the chromatogram supplied. Look for peaks eluting close to the main peak, since those are the deletion sequences and a summary percentage hides them.

The full construct written out including the non-coded residues and their configurations, because a name does not specify which positions are D and which are L.

Whether the carboxy terminus is amidated. The free acid has a different mass and different activity and it is a routine synthesis failure.

Counterion identity together with net peptide content. A basic lysine on a 712 dalton backbone gives a proportionally larger trifluoroacetate share than any long peptide carries, commonly near twenty percent.

Lot number and synthesis date.

A certificate omitting the amidation status is the most common gap on this compound, and it is the one that changes the molecule most for the least visible reason.

A note on reading the chromatogram rather than the number attached to it. Purity by area percent assumes every species present absorbs at the detection wavelength in proportion to its quantity.

For deletion sequences of the same peptide that assumption is close to true. For a non-peptide contaminant it can be badly wrong, since something that does not absorb at 214 nanometres contributes nothing to the area and still occupies mass in the vial.

What Is Unusual About the Receptor?

GHS-R1a has a property that is easy to overlook and that shapes how any experiment on it should be designed.

It is constitutively active. The receptor produces substantial signalling in the absence of any ligand, reported in the region of half its maximal activity in several published systems.

Most G-protein coupled receptors sit near silent until something binds them. This one does not.

The consequence is that a baseline measurement in a GHS-R1a system is not a zero. It is a raised starting point, and a compound added to that system is modulating an active receptor rather than switching on an inactive one.

That changes what a control means. An untreated well is not an unstimulated well, and the difference between them is the constitutive signal.

It also creates a category of compound that has no equivalent in a silent receptor system. An inverse agonist reduces signalling below the unliganded baseline, which is only a coherent idea where an unliganded baseline exists to fall below.

Ipamorelin peptide is an agonist rather than an inverse agonist, and the point here is what the assay reports rather than what the compound does.

A response expressed as fold-change over baseline compresses differently in a constitutively active system than in a silent one, so two laboratories quoting fold-change can disagree while measuring the same thing.

Reporting absolute signal alongside fold-change resolves it. That is a small change to a results table and it removes an argument that otherwise recurs.

The receptor was cloned in 1996 and its natural ligand was identified three years later, so this property was characterised well before the ligand was known.

How Stable Is It Once Reconstituted?

This compound is unusually well behaved in solution, and the reason is what the sequence does not contain.

There is no methionine, so there is no oxidation-sensitive side chain of the kind that limits most peptides in this catalogue.

There is no asparagine or glutamine, so deamidation has nothing to act on.

There is no cysteine, so there is no disulfide to scramble and no free thiol to oxidise.

There is no aspartate-glycine motif, so the isomerisation route that quietly ruins bioregulator solutions is absent.

What remains is a short, amidated, partly D-configured chain with no chemically labile side chain at all, which is close to the best case for aqueous stability in a synthetic peptide.

That does not make a reconstituted solution indefinitely usable, and the limits are physical and microbiological rather than chemical.

Adsorption removes peptide from dilute solutions into container walls, which is a loss of concentration rather than a change in the molecule, and it is worst at the lowest working dilutions.

Microbial growth is the other limit. Bacteriostatic diluent addresses it and plain water does not, and a solution held at 4 degrees Celsius in unpreserved water is a growth medium with a peptide in it.

So the honest storage answer for ipamorelin peptide is that chemistry is rarely what ends a solution here. Handling and contamination are, and both are controllable.

How Should the Vial Be Handled?

Ipamorelin peptide is more forgiving than most of the catalogue, within limits, being short and amidated.

Sealed dry powder holds at refrigeration temperature for short periods and at minus 20 for extended storage, with light excluded throughout.

Bring the vial to room temperature before opening. The powder is hygroscopic and cold glass condenses atmospheric moisture immediately.

A 10 mg vial of a 712 dalton peptide contains a large molar quantity, which is the practical argument for this size over the smaller one when a study runs several arms.

Reconstitute by adding diluent down the wall and swirling. Five residues aggregate less readily than forty-four and the habit is worth keeping regardless.

Aliquot on first reconstitution. The molar quantity in a 10 mg vial makes repeated freeze-thaw of the whole volume wasteful as well as damaging.

Use low-binding consumables at working dilutions, since adsorption removes a fraction of any dilute peptide from small-volume plastics.

Record lot, net peptide content, diluent volume and date of first reconstitution, which is the minimum set another laboratory needs to reproduce the preparation.
